Abstract

The invention discloses a high-efficient spraying maishi paint. The high-efficient spraying maishi paint comprises water, ethylene glycol monobutyl ether, corrosion remover, cellulose, a pH regulating agent, a pure acrylic emulsion, a styrene-acrylic emulsion, a film-forming auxiliary, an antifoaming agent, snowflake white and a thickening agent serving as raw materials. The invention also discloses a method for preparing the high-efficient spraying maishi paint. The maishi paint provided by the invention is unique and reasonable in formulation design; pure acrylic emulsion is matched with styrene-acrylic emulsion, so that the comprehensive performance of the maishi paint is high, and the weather resistance is improved well; cellulose having a mould-proof anti-algae function is added, so that the suspension property and the lubricating property of the maishi paint are effectively improved, the discharging mobility is high and the constructability is high; therefore, the texture coating is suitable for large-area construction of the large-scale high-efficient spraying machine, high in spraying efficiency and uniform in spraying. A preparation method provided by the invention is simple in process, easy to realize, high in production efficiency; the working period is greatly reduced, the construction efficiency is effectively improved, and a large quantity of labours are reduced; the prepared maishi paint has good quality and is beneficial to wide popularization and application.

Background technology
True mineral varnish is that a kind of decorative effect exactly likes marble, granite.Main adopt versicolor natural stone-powder formulated, the buildings behind the true mineral varnish finishing has natural real natural colour, gives elegance, harmony, and serious aesthetic feeling is suitable for the indoor and outdoor decoration of all kinds of buildingss.Particularly decorate at the curved-surface building thing, can receive vivid, the effect of back to nature.
Present true mineral varnish on the market, generally be only applicable to small-sized spray gun, material loading is slow, spray inhomogeneous, spray area is little (people one day spray 100-150 square meter), adding cost of labor increases, cause the engineering construction time long, need be artificial many, scaffolding and hanging basket lease time are long, and construction cost is doubled and redoubled, waste time and energy the waste resource.
So it is good to research and develop a kind of discharging fluency, be fit to efficient spraying machine, and the spray efficiency height, spray evenly, effective, the duration is shortened greatly, reduce the true mineral varnish of efficient spraying of construction cost for working as the required of generation.

For achieving the above object, technical scheme provided by the present invention is: the true mineral varnish of a kind of efficient spraying, and its raw material comprises following components in weight percentage:
First part of water 7.0~15.0 ﹪,
Ethylene glycol monobutyl ether 0.5~1.0 ﹪,
Sanitas 0.1~0.3%,
Mierocrystalline cellulose 0.15~0.3%,
PH conditioning agent 0.1~0.2%,
Pure-acrylic emulsion 5~10%,
Benzene emulsion 5~10%,
Film coalescence aid 0.5~1.0%,
Defoamer 0.05~0.2%,
30~60 order Snow Flower Whites 10~20%,
75~85 order Snow Flower Whites 30~60%,
95~105 order Snow Flower Whites 10~20%,
Thickening material 0.15~0.3%,
Second part of water 0.15~0.3%.
As a kind of improvement of the present invention, described Mierocrystalline cellulose is that model is the Natvosol of ER-30M, and this Natvosol itself possesses the mildew-resistant algae-resistant function, improves suspension and the oilness of true mineral varnish simultaneously.
As a kind of improvement of the present invention, described PH conditioning agent is that model is the PH conditioning agent of AMP-95.
As a kind of improvement of the present invention, described pure-acrylic emulsion is that model is the pure-acrylic emulsion of RS-706T, and described benzene emulsion is that model is the benzene emulsion of RS991HA.
As a kind of improvement of the present invention, described thickening material is that model is the thickening material of TT-935, and described sanitas is that model is the sanitas of LXE, and described film coalescence aid is that model is the film coalescence aid of TEXANOL, and described defoamer is that model is the defoamer of NXZ.
A kind of preparation method who prepares the true mineral varnish of above-mentioned efficient spraying, it may further comprise the steps:
(1) preparing material, raw material comprise following components in weight percentage:
First part of water 7.0~15.0 ﹪,
Ethylene glycol monobutyl ether 0.5~1.0 ﹪,
Sanitas 0.1~0.3%,
Mierocrystalline cellulose 0.15~0.3%,
PH conditioning agent 0.1~0.2%,
Pure-acrylic emulsion 5~10%,
Benzene emulsion 5~10%,
Film coalescence aid 0.5~1.0%,
Defoamer 0.05~0.2%,
30~60 order Snow Flower Whites 10~20%,
75~85 order Snow Flower Whites 30~60%,
95~105 order Snow Flower Whites 10~20%,
Thickening material 0.15~0.3%,
Second part of water 0.15~0.3%;
(2) earlier first part of water is dropped into mixing equipment, under whipped state, add ethylene glycol monobutyl ether and sanitas successively;
(3) Mierocrystalline cellulose is added mixing equipment, stirred 10~30 minutes, to dissolving fully, add the PH conditioning agent then;
(4) pure-acrylic emulsion and benzene emulsion are added mixing equipment, under whipped state, slowly add film coalescence aid and defoamer;
(5) under whipped state, 30~60 order Snow Flower Whites, 75~85 order Snow Flower Whites and 95~105 order Snow Flower Whites are added mixing equipment, and stir;
(6) in advance thickening material and second part of water are mixed, slowly add mixing equipment then, make the true mineral varnish of efficient spraying.
As a kind of improvement of the present invention, described step (6) may further comprise the steps: (6.1) mix thickening material and second part of water in advance, make mixture; (6.2) slowly mixture is added mixing equipment then, until reaching working viscosity; (6.3) to be detected qualified after, pack into storehouse, make the true mineral varnish of efficient spraying.

Embodiment
Embodiment 1: the true mineral varnish of a kind of efficient spraying that present embodiment provides, and its raw material comprises following components in weight percentage: first part of water 9 ﹪, ethylene glycol monobutyl ether 0.8 ﹪, sanitas 0.3%, Mierocrystalline cellulose 0.15%, PH conditioning agent 0.1%, pure-acrylic emulsion 10%, benzene emulsion 6%, film coalescence aid 0.7%, defoamer 0.2%, 30~60 order Snow Flower Whites, 12%, 75~85 order Snow Flower Whites, 40.45%, 95~105 order Snow Flower Whites 20%, 0.15%, the second part of water 0.15% of thickening material.
Described Mierocrystalline cellulose is that model is the Natvosol of ER-30M, and this Natvosol itself possesses the mildew-resistant algae-resistant function, improves suspension and the oilness of true mineral varnish simultaneously.
Described PH conditioning agent is that model is the PH conditioning agent of AMP-95.
Described pure-acrylic emulsion is that model is the pure-acrylic emulsion of RS-706T.
Described benzene emulsion is that model is the benzene emulsion of RS991HA.
Described thickening material is that model is the thickening material of TT-935.
Described sanitas is that model is the sanitas of LXE.
Described film coalescence aid is that model is the film coalescence aid of TEXANOL.Described defoamer is that model is the defoamer of NXZ.

Performance checking result such as table 1 to the true mineral varnish of the efficient spraying of product of the present invention according to the dependence test standard.
Table 1.
Project Technical indicator, parameter
Color Multiple color (special-purpose colour atla) for reference also can be modulated by customer requirement
Solids content Quality solids content 〉=60%
Application property Spraying does not have difficulty
Water tolerance (96h) No change
Alkali resistance (96h) No abnormal
Time of drying (surface drying) 2h
Abrasion resistance 〉=2000 times
Shock-resistance The coating flawless peels off and obviously distortion
The adhesion strength of standard state ≥0.7mpa
Intensity behind degree of the invading water ≥0.5mpa
By the performance index in the table 1 as can be seen, the over-all properties that the invention provides the true mineral varnish of efficient spraying is superior, good weatherability and self intensity height, but application property is strong, the large-area construction that can be fit to large-scale efficient spraying machine, and spray efficiency height, spraying are evenly, duration is shortened greatly, reduce construction cost.
